Bozsok
Village
Photo: Pan Peter12, CC BY 3.0.
Bozsok is a village in Vas County, Hungary. It is mentioned in some records from the 13th century. It is near the remains of some Roman water pipes. It lies at the foot of the Kőszeg Mountains on the border with Austria, having Rechnitz on the other side. Bozsok is situated 4½ km northeast of Rechnitz.
Velem
Village
Photo: Civertan,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Velem is a village in Vas county, Hungary. The village is situated on the slopes of Kőszeg Mountains, at the westernmost tip of the county and the region known as Alpokalja. Velem is notable for its picturesque environment and healthy climate. Velem is situated 6 km northeast of Rechnitz.
Bucsu
Village
Photo: Pasztilla,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Bucsu is a village in Vas County, Hungary, in the vicinity of Szombathely. It is on the border with Austria, and there is a road crossing the border from Bucsu to Rechnitz and Schachendorf. Bucsu is situated 6 km southeast of Rechnitz.
